def _deserialize_blobs(artifact_type, blobs_from_db, artifact_properties):
    """Retrieves blobs from database"""
    for blob_name, blob_value in six.iteritems(blobs_from_db):
        if not blob_value:
            continue
        if isinstance(artifact_type.metadata.attributes.blobs.get(blob_name),
                      declarative.ListAttributeDefinition):
            val = []
            for v in blob_value:
                b = definitions.Blob(size=v['size'],
                                     locations=v['locations'],
                                     checksum=v['checksum'],
                                     item_key=v['item_key'])
                val.append(b)
        elif len(blob_value) == 1:
            val = definitions.Blob(size=blob_value[0]['size'],
                                   locations=blob_value[0]['locations'],
                                   checksum=blob_value[0]['checksum'],
                                   item_key=blob_value[0]['item_key'])
        else:
            raise exception.InvalidArtifactPropertyValue(
                message=_('Blob %(name)s may not have multiple values'),
                name=blob_name)
        artifact_properties[blob_name] = val

    def __pre_publish__(self, context, *args, **kwargs):
        super(ImageAsAnArtifact, self).__pre_publish__(*args, **kwargs)
        if self.file is None and self.legacy_image_id is None:
            raise exception.InvalidArtifactPropertyValue(
                message=_("Either a file or a legacy_image_id has to be "
                          "specified"))
        if self.file is not None and self.legacy_image_id is not None:
            raise exception.InvalidArtifactPropertyValue(
                message=_("Both file and legacy_image_id may not be "
                          "specified at the same time"))

        if self.legacy_image_id:
            glance_endpoint = next(service['endpoints'][0]['publicURL']
                                   for service in context.service_catalog
                                   if service['name'] == 'glance')
            # Ensure glanceclient is imported correctly since we are catching
            # the ImportError on initialization
            if glanceclient == None:
                raise ImportError(_("Glance client not installed"))

            try:
                client = glanceclient.Client(version=2,
                                             endpoint=glance_endpoint,
                                             token=context.auth_token)
                legacy_image = client.images.get(self.legacy_image_id)
            except Exception:
                raise exception.InvalidArtifactPropertyValue(
                    message=_('Unable to get legacy image'))
            if legacy_image is not None:
                self.file = definitions.Blob(size=legacy_image.size,
                                             locations=[{
                                                 "status":
                                                 "active",
                                                 "value":
                                                 legacy_image.direct_url
                                             }],
                                             checksum=legacy_image.checksum,
                                             item_key=legacy_image.id)
            else:
                raise exception.InvalidArtifactPropertyValue(
                    message=_("Legacy image was not found"))
